Bilingual speaker in Spanish or Portuguese Needed
#1
Posted 27 November 2011 - 02:37 PM
Hey, we're currently looking for someone who is fluent or native in both English AND Spanish or Portuguese to help us pilot a Sonic Retro project over the next month or so. We'll need you to do a few hours a week of translating written pieces as an experiment, so strong language skills are a must. We would prefer someone who speaks either Brazilian Portuguese or Latin/South American Spanish, but are willing to work with European speakers of those two languages.
If you are interested, please contact me directly over PM with times you are usually on Sonic Retro.
